The Dawns Here Are Quiet

1972YEAR188′RUNTIMEStanislav RostotskiDIRECTOR

SYNOPSIS

The Dawns Here Are Quiet (Russian: А зори здесь тихие, romanized: A zori zdes tikhiye) is a 1972 Soviet war drama directed by Stanislav Rostotsky based on Boris Vasilyev's novel of the same name, The Dawns Here Are Quiet. The film deals with antiwar themes and focuses on a garrison of Russian female soldiers in World War II. It was nominated for an Oscar in the Best Foreign Language Film category. The film is set in Karelia (near Finland) and was filmed near Ruskeala.
